Growing
Hawthorn prefers sunny to partially shaded locations with well-drained, humus-rich soil. Regular but moderate watering is important, especially in summer. Propagation is done by semi-hardwood cuttings in summer or hardwood cuttings in late winter. Fertilizing with compost or manure can be done in autumn. It does not tolerate drought well.
